Chocolate Chip Olive Oil Zucchini Banana Bread

This bread is packed full of zucchini and banana and is quick to make!

Ingredients

16 servings
  • 2 medium zucchini, grated ((about 1 1/2-2 cups grated))
  • 3 medium over ripe bananas, mashed
  • 1/2 cup extra virgin olive oil
  • 1/2 cup real maple syrup
  • 2 eggs
  • 2 teaspoons vanilla extract
  • 1 1/2 cups white whole wheat flour
  • 1 cup all-purpose flour
  • 2 teaspoons baking powder
  • 1 teaspoon kosher salt
  • 1/4 teaspoon cinnamon
  • 1/2 cup semi-sweet or dark chocolate chips

Steps

  1. 1. Preheat the oven to 350 degrees F. Grease a 9x5 inch loaf pan and line with parchment paper.2. Lay a clean kitchen towel on the counter and spread the zucchini out on the towel, cover with another clean towel and let sit 10 minutes, then squeeze out any excess water. 3. Meanwhile, in a mixing bowl, combine the banana, olive oil, maple syrup, eggs, and vanilla until well combined. Stir in the flours, baking powder, salt and cinnamon until just combined. Fold in the chocolate chips and zucchini.4. Pour the batter into the prepared loaf pan. Bake for 45-50 minutes, or until center is set. If the top begins to brown, tent the bread with foil. Remove and let cool for at least 30 minutes before cutting (or just eat it warm). Bread will keep (covered) for 3-5 days.
